A deep dive into American society's issues with the lack of focus on health in multiple capacities from physical to psychological, and all of the emotions that come with this major issue. Emotions are hard wired into our biology and are crucial to our health and the decisions we make regarding our health. Our purpose with this podcast is to encourage others to embrace their emotions regarding their health, and to reflect on themselves and what changes they can make to improve their health.
